Abstract

Abstract: The proper management of medical waste is crucial to ensure the safety and well-being of both healthcare workers and the general public. Traditional methods of medical waste disposal, such as incineration and landfilling, have significant environmental and health risks. The creation of biogas from medical waste provides a sustainable and eco-friendly option for waste management and energy demands. Biogas production from medical waste offers several benefits. Firstly, it provides a renewable source of energy, reducing reliance on fossil fuels and mitigating greenhouse gas emissions. Second, it makes it easier to handle waste properly, reducing the hazards that medical waste poses to the environment and human health. A further way that biogas production may support the circular economy is by turning garbage into a useful resource. However, overcoming a number of obstacles is necessary for efficient biogas generation from medical waste. These include managing any possible pollutants or hazardous materials that may be present in medical waste, as well as the appropriate segregation and collection of medical waste. To further encourage and assist the development of biogas generation from medical waste, legislative frameworks, and regulatory measures are crucial. Recent improvements in biogas production technology, such as the use of sophisticated anaerobic digestion systems and the integration of pre-treatment techniques, have shown encouraging results in increasing the efficiency and dependability of the process. Additionally, cutting-edge methods have been investigated to improve biogas output and quality, such as co-digestion with other organic waste streams or the utilization of microbial consortia.
